128GB DDR5 RDIMM kit for workstations

This kit provides 128GB of registered ECC memory across eight 16GB modules. It is built for compatible Intel Xeon W-3400X workstation platforms that require registered DIMMs with error correction. The modules operate at DDR5 6000 with a CL30 latency profile. Buyers needing unbuffered UDIMMs or non-ECC memory should look elsewhere.

Registered ECC with 288-pin DDR5 interface

Each module is a 288-pin DDR5 RDIMM rated at 6000 MT/s (PC5 48000) with timings of 30-39-39-96 at 1.40V. The registered buffer and on-die ECC plus side-band ECC are the single specification that determines compatibility; the motherboard must support registered ECC DDR5 and the W790 chipset with eight-channel architecture. Systems without registered memory support cannot use this kit.

Fits Intel W790 octo-channel workstations

The eight-module population fills all channels on a W790 motherboard designed for Xeon W-3400X processors. Intel XMP 3.0 profiles simplify configuration when the platform allows overclocked memory operation. Dedicated on-module temperature sensors assist thermal monitoring. Builders using consumer chipsets, fewer than eight channels, or unbuffered memory slots cannot install this product.

Questions about this item

What does the DDR5 6000 speed rating mean when the kit is installed in a workstation?

The kit runs at 6000 MT/s with CL30-39-39-96 timings at 1.40 V when the XMP 3.0 profile is enabled on a compatible Intel W790 motherboard.

How does the registered DDR5 interface with ECC affect data integrity and throughput?

The RDIMM modules include on-die ECC and side-band ECC, providing error correction for each 16 GB module while the register buffers address and command signals for stable octo-channel operation.

What physical slot and motherboard layout are required for the 8-module kit?

The kit uses 288-pin DDR5 RDIMM modules and requires an Intel W790 chipset motherboard with eight memory slots to populate all 8 x 16 GB modules.
